Heron island and the great barrier reef are a significant nesting location for two threatened sea turtle species, the green turtle (chelonia mydas) and the loggerhead turtle (caretta caretta). Naturalist guides on heron island lead educational tours every evening when its best to view the turtles hatching.

Heron island, a national marine park situated in the southern end of the great barrier reef, is a significant nesting location for two threatened sea turtle species, the green turtle and the loggerhead turtle.
